Try scoring a touchdown for your team. Every offensive team in football is looking for touchdowns. A player carries the ball down the field and over the opposite team’s end zone goal line, or catches the ball there. Should the ball break the goal line in a player’s possession, this scores a touchdown. A touchdown is worth 6 points.

Shoulder Pads

Shoulder pads are an obvious yet essential aspect to protective football gear. It is crucial that they fit correctly. Make sure they aren’t moving around and in tip top shape. Shoulder pads in poor condition can cause injuries if they fail during a hit.
